Directed by the legendary Ernst Lubitsch, this 1930 film is a cornerstone of early cinema and a defining film in the "Monte Carlo" canon. It's a quintessential example of the sophisticated romantic comedies that would come to define Lubitsch's style, characterized by wit, elegance, and innuendo—a style often referred to as the "Lubitsch touch".

The plot is propelled by classic cinematic wish-fulfillment. When their budget-friendly trip to the City of Light turns into a series of disappointments, the trio find themselves inexplicably launched into a world of unimaginable wealth. The catalyst is Grace (played by Selena Gomez), who is mistaken by the international press for the snobbish, reclusive British heiress Cordelia Winthrop-Scott. Seizing an unexpected opportunity to escape their travel woes, the three friends—Grace, her uptight stepsister Meg (Leighton Meester), and her best friend Emma (Katie Cassidy)—decide to embrace the lie. They are whisked away from a dreary hostel to the palatial Hotel de Paris in Monte Carlo, where they are treated like royalty, don designer gowns, and are swept into a world of charity galas, polo matches, and whirlwind romances.
